Global impact / market context

If AI governance disputes escalate, investors might sell crypto like Ether to reduce risk, pushing prices down and hurting companies that hold crypto assets or accept crypto payments.

Analyst inference

Cryptocurrency prices often react to influential figures' statements, and a prominent voice like Buterin's can shift market mood, especially when combined with broader tech sector uncertainty.
